About The AAPS Journal

The AAPS Journal (ISSN 1550-7416) is an online-only quarterly journal publishing reviews, theme issues and research articles in the scope of pharmaceutical sciences encompassed by the AAPS membership. Special emphasis is placed on increasing dissemination of scientific presentations made at AAPS-sponsored meetings, workshops and symposia. Because of its electronic nature, The AAPS Journal aspires to utilize evolving electronic technology to enable faster and diverse mechanisms of information delivery to its readership. The Journal is indexed by PubMed/Medline, Index Medicus, Institute of Scientific Information's Science Citation Index and Chem Abstracts.

Editor-in-Chief, Ho-Leung Fung, Ph.D., oversees an international editorial board of leading researchers in the pharmaceutical sciences. Dr. Fung is Professor of Pharmaceutical Sciences at the University at Buffalo, The State University of New York.
